Living in La Mesa

La Mesa offers an excellent Southern California lifestyle with the convenience of being close to San Diego while maintaining a welcoming community atmosphere.

Known as the Jewel of the Hills, La Mesa provides easy access to local restaurants, cafés, breweries, parks and community events. The area offers plenty of outdoor opportunities, with nearby hiking trails, parks and quick access to destinations including Mission Trails Regional Park and the surrounding mountains.

San Diego's beaches, downtown attractions, professional sports, cultural venues and world-class dining are all within easy reach, while nearby communities provide additional opportunities for recreation and entertainment.

With year-round sunshine, excellent access to the outdoors and a more relaxed community feel than some of the larger surrounding areas, La Mesa is an outstanding location for veterinarians looking to build a career in Southern California.
